About 9-[4-(1-aminopropyl)phenyl]-8-methoxy-6-methyl-5H-thieno[2,3-c]quinolin-4-one
9-[4-(1-aminopropyl)phenyl]-8-methoxy-6-methyl-5H-thieno[2,3-c]quinolin-4-one (PubChem CID 67447177) has the molecular formula C22H22N2O2S
and a molecular weight of 378.50 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 9-[4-(1-aminopropyl)phenyl]-8-methoxy-6-methyl-5H-thieno[2,3-c]quinolin-4-one.

What is the SMILES notation for 9-[4-(1-aminopropyl)phenyl]-8-methoxy-6-methyl-5H-thieno[2,3-c]quinolin-4-one?
The canonical SMILES for 9-[4-(1-aminopropyl)phenyl]-8-methoxy-6-methyl-5H-thieno[2,3-c]quinolin-4-one is CCC(N)c1ccc(-c2c(OC)cc(C)c3[nH]c(=O)c4sccc4c23)cc1.
What is the InChIKey of 9-[4-(1-aminopropyl)phenyl]-8-methoxy-6-methyl-5H-thieno[2,3-c]quinolin-4-one?
The InChIKey is KCLWEERDMRRSAJ-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C22H22N2O2S/c1-4-16(23)13-5-7-14(8-6-13)18-17(26-3)11-12(2)20-19(18)15-9-10-27-21(15)22(25)24-20/h5-11,16H,4,23H2,1-3H3,(H,24,25).
What are the key properties of 9-[4-(1-aminopropyl)phenyl]-8-methoxy-6-methyl-5H-thieno[2,3-c]quinolin-4-one?
9-[4-(1-aminopropyl)phenyl]-8-methoxy-6-methyl-5H-thieno[2,3-c]quinolin-4-one has a molecular weight of 378.50 g/mol, XLogP of 5.14, 4 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
